South Dakota Legislators Face Busy Session

South Dakota lawmakers will have to get off to a quick start with all the issues in front of them.
Veteran Senator Jim Bolin of Canton says marijuana legislation will take considerable time….

There are at least thirty eight bills on file dealing with marijuana in some form.
Bolin says the impeachment process of Attorney General Jason Ravnsborg will have an impact….

Bolin says all the available state and federal dollars will also take time to sort through….

The session officially starts today (Tuesday) and is scheduled to wrap up the main run on March 10th.
